Pubblicato il 16 giugno
Mansioni della posizione
Siamo alla ricerca di un/una AI Data Engineer che si occupi della progettazione, sviluppo e ottimizzazione di soluzioni basate su modelli di Intelligenza Artificiale generativa (LLM). La figura lavorerà su architetture moderne e scalabili, integrando tecniche avanzate di prompting, sistemi di retrieval intelligente (RAG), orchestrazione agentica e meccanismi di sicurezza. Il ruolo si colloca all'intersezione tra software engineering, machine learning applicato e MLOps, con l'obiettivo di costruire applicazioni AI modulari, affidabili e cloud-native. È prevista la possibilità di operare su infrastrutture cloud (AWS, GCP, Azure), sfruttando anche i servizi GenAI offerti nativamente dai principali provider (es. Amazon Bedrock, Vertex AI, Azure OpenAI).
Ha le carte in regola per avere successo? Le seguenti informazioni devono essere lette attentamente da tutti i candidati.
Il Tuo Contributo In Questo Ruolo
Progettare architetture agentiche, individuando le soluzioni più efficaci in base al contesto e ai requisiti di progetto
Sviluppare pipeline di prompting, gestione tool, memoria e context window
Integrare framework agentici open-source e protocollo MCP nei flussi applicativi
Progettare e ottimizzare soluzioni RAG (Retrieval-Augmented Generation) utilizzando Vector Database e strategie di retrieval avanzate
Definire metriche ed eseguire attività di valutazione (LLM-as-Judge, trajectory evaluation, metriche tradizionali)
Garantire osservabilità e monitoraggio degli agenti in ambienti di produzione
Applicare best practice di sicurezza (guardrails, gestione accessi, rate limiting, protezione dei dati e PII, mitigazione delle hallucination)
Gestire pipeline CI/CD, versionamento delle dipendenze e qualità del codice
Effettuare il deployment su piattaforme cloud e ambienti gestiti
Collaborare con il team contribuendo con analisi critica e approccio data-driven
Il Profilo Ideale
Ottima conoscenza di Python (classi, moduli, REST API, async programming, strutture dati)
Esperienza in ambienti cloud (AWS, GCP o Azure) e servizi correlati (es. Docker, IAM, Storage, Cloud Run, Vertex AI)
Esperienza con almeno un framework agentico (es. LangGraph, Semantic Kernel, ADK, OpenAI SDK)
Fondamenti di Machine Learning e Deep Learning
Conoscenza dei principali componenti dello sviluppo agentico: LLM, prompting (zero-shot, CoT, ReAct), gestione context window, tool e memoria
Esperienza nella progettazione di architetture agentiche e valutazione dei relativi trade-off
Esperienza con pipeline RAG e Vector Database
Esperienza nell'utilizzo di Git e gestione delle dipendenze (pip, poetry, uv)
Conoscenza della programmazione a oggetti, design pattern e principi di clean code
Conoscenza di base di CI/CD (es. GitHub Actions)
Conoscenza delle tematiche di sicurezza (guardrails, least-privilege, rate limiting, gestione PII, mitigazione delle hallucination)
Buona conoscenza della lingua inglese
Location: Bari, Napoli, Roma
Costruisci il tuo futuro con NTT DATA.
Entra a far parte di un'azienda globale, leader nei servizi di business e tecnologici, che ascolta la tua voce e riconosce il valore del tuo lavoro. Collaborerai con clienti, partner e colleghi di tutto il mondo per creare soluzioni innovative capaci di avere un impatto reale sulla società. Qui potrai sviluppare nuove competenze e ampliare il tuo network.
Siamo presenti in Italia con oltre **** dipendenti a Milano, Roma, Torino, Genova, Bologna, Treviso, Pisa, Padova, Napoli, Cosenza, Bari e Salerno. xrdztoy
Make this the place where you grow.
Unisciti a noi!